Lieutenant-General SIR WILLIAM PULTENEY PULTENEY (1861 - 1941) British general during the First World War. In command of British III Corps, then headed 23rd Army Corps

EDITORS COMMENTS
This striking photograph captures the distinguished visage of Sir William Pulteney Pulteney (1861-1941), a prominent British general during the First World War. Sir William served with great distinction in the military, holding command of British III Corps and later heading the 23rd Army Corps. Born into the noble Pulteney family, Sir William's military career began in the Grenadier Guards in 1881. He rose through the ranks, demonstrating exceptional leadership and strategic acumen. During the First World War, Sir William's leadership proved invaluable, particularly during the Battle of the Somme in 1916. His III Corps played a crucial role in the capture of the village of Beaumont-Hamel, a key objective in the initial assault. After the Battle of the Somme, Sir William was appointed to head the 23rd Army Corps, where he continued to lead his troops with great success. His military prowess was recognized with several honors, including the Knight Commander of the Order of the Bath (KCB) and the Knight Grand Cross of the Order of the Bath (GCB). As the years passed, Sir William's legacy as a respected military leader grew. His strategic insights and unwavering commitment to his troops served as an inspiration to future generations of British military leaders. This photograph, taken in the early 1900s, stands as a testament to Sir William's illustrious military career and his enduring place in the annals of British military history.
